Pavel Sterec (1985, Prague) is an artist. He is head of the Studio of Intermedia at the Faculty of Fine Arts of Technical University, Brno. His works include performance, object, installation, photography and other media. His interest circles around the issues of research, science, museums and archives, social structures and our dependency on tangible or symbolic capital.

Pavel Sterec studied in Brno, Prague, and Vienna, and graduated from the Academy of Fine Arts (AVU) in Prague, where he studied under Vladimír Skrepl, Jiří Kovanda, Zbigniew Libera and Pawel Althamer (2012). He received his PhD from the Studio of Photography at the Academy of Fine Arts (AVU) in Prague (2016). He organised and curated Tu I Onde performance festival (2005, 2006), and Here2Hear, a visual and sound art exhibition within Sperm festival in Prague (2007). Sterec was a member of Kunst-ruch-ter and Lemurie radio (from 2005). He took part in numerous international projects and festivals including Recyclart (Brussels, 2004), Transmediale (Berlin, 2006) and Multiplace (Bratislava, 2006).
